Second race in Austria makes little ‘sense' – Alonso

Jun.28 Fernando Alonso has questioned the 'sense' of staging a second consecutive race at the Red Bull Ring this weekend. While many races this year were close and exciting, Sunday's event in Austria was clearly dominated by Red Bull's championship leader Max Verstappen. And Alonso, the highly experienced two-time champion, thinks Formula 1 fans will see a similar outcome this weekend. 'For next weekend we will have to think about whether it rains or something, because the cars are going to be the same – we will see a similar weekend,' the 39-year-old Spaniard said.
